Flat roof repair services involve inspecting, maintaining, and restoring flat roofing systems to ensure they remain watertight and structurally sound. These services typically include identifying areas of damage or wear, repairing leaks, patching cracks, and replacing damaged sections of roofing material. Skilled contractors use specialized tools and techniques to address issues efficiently, helping to extend the lifespan of the roof and prevent further damage. Regular maintenance and timely repairs can help homeowners avoid more costly fixes down the line and keep their property protected from the elements.

Many common problems that lead property owners to seek flat roof repair services include ponding water, leaks, blistering, and cracking. Flat roofs are more prone to water pooling because of their design, which can cause water to seep into the roofing layers if not properly maintained. Leaks often occur around seams, flashing, or penetrations like vents and skylights. Over time, exposure to weather can cause the roofing material to deteriorate, leading to cracks or blistering that compromise the roof’s integrity. Addressing these issues promptly can prevent water damage to the interior of the building and preserve the overall condition of the roof.

The overview below groups typical Flat Roof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Somerset County, NJ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or flat roof repairs, such as patching small leaks or replacing damaged flashing,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ials used.

Medium-Sized Projects - When repairs involve larger sections or more extensive patchwork, costs can range from $600-$1,500. These projects are common for homeowners addressing multiple issues or moderate wear over time.

Full Roof Replacement - Complete flat roof replacements in Somerset County often fall between $4,000 and $8,000, with larger or more complex projects potentially exceeding $10,000. Many local contractors handle projects in this range, depending on size and material choices.

Extensive or Commercial Work - Larger, more complex projects, such as commercial flat roof replacements or significant structural repairs, can reach $15,000 or more. These jobs are less frequent but are handled by experienced service providers for substantial roofing need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a flat roof needs repair? Signs include water pooling, visible cracks or blisters, and leaks inside the building. If these issues are noticed, it’s advisable to have a professional inspection to determine necessary repairs.

Can flat roof repairs be a temporary fix or are they permanent? Repairs can vary from temporary patching to more permanent solutions, depending on the roof’s condition and the extent of damage. Consulting local contractors can help identify the best approach.

What types of damage are typically repaired on flat roofs? Common damages include punctures, cracks, blistering, and membrane deterioration. Service providers can assess the specific damage and recommend appropriate repair methods.

Are there different repair options for flat roofs made of various materials? Yes, repair techniques can differ based on the roofing material, such as built-up roofing, EPDM, or TPO. Local contractors can advise on the most suitable repair options for each material.

How can I prevent future damage to my flat roof? Regular inspections, prompt repairs of minor issues, and maintaining proper drainage can help prevent future damage. Service providers can offer guidance tailored to specific roof types and conditions.
